War by Candlelight: Stories by Daniel Alarcon

4.0

I really, really enjoyed this book. The stories, because they were so short, kept me very engaged and interested in the book. Furthermore, each story was like a puzzle to me, so I enjoyed trying to solve it and piece everything together. Aside from that, the deep, current issues the book touches on intrigued me, especially because many of them were based in Lima, Peru, and since I don't know too much about South America, it was nice to see a new perspective, hear new opinions, and just generally learn a bit more about the area. I recommend this book to anyone that likes to read (obviously) and wants a quick, engaging read that will make them more aware of issues and ways of life in other countries.
